Well, he is defeated by a side villain, (mainly because he was stuck in a PSTD style flashback and she wield's his main weakness (lighting) with skill). And he struggles with the main villlans, but he succseds in the end, he has a weakness.
In the past? yes. And again the actual story. He is shown to be awesome at first, but is then shown he can be defeated, just like anyone else. Although he gets back up all the time.
A hero that never gets defeated is probably not being challenged enough.
Fatal error: Uncaught TypeError: array_slice(): Argument #1 ($array) must be of type array, bool given in /var/www/web/proprofsdiscuss.com/SSI/function_live.php:661
Stack trace:
#0 /var/www/web/proprofsdiscuss.com/SSI/function_live.php(661): array_slice()
#1 /var/www/web/proprofsdiscuss.com/SSI/function_live.php(3752): related_popular_ques()
#2 /var/www/web/proprofsdiscuss.com/question.php(1147): get_related_qsn()
#3 {main}
thrown in /var/www/web/proprofsdiscuss.com/SSI/function_live.php on line 661